SEAI Energy Contracting Support Scheme

SEAI Energy Contracting Support Scheme

Funds Irish energy contracting advisory costs for decarbonisation projects.

The SEAI Energy Contracting Support Scheme provides financial assistance for businesses and public sector organisations delivering energy efficiency and decarbonisation projects through Energy Performance Contracts, Local Energy Supply Contracts, and Energy Performance Guarantees.

External consultancy and specialist advisory costs for energy performance contracts, local energy supply contracts, energy performance guarantees, feasibility studies, business cases, financial analysis, legal advice, and procurement evaluation.
